Special Education in the Philippines. 1902 - The interest to educate Filipino children with disabilities was expressed through Mr. Fred Atkinson, the General Superintendent of Education. 1907 - Special Education was formally started in the country by establishing the Insular School for the Deaf and Blind in Manila.Identify what the emerging issues in special education are, and learn about what special education is like today. The Individuals with Disabilities Education Act ( IDEA) is a piece of American legislation that ensures students with a disability are provided with a Free Appropriate Public Education (FAPE) that is tailored to their individual needs. IDEA was previously known as the Education for All Handicapped Children Act (EHA) from 1975 to 1990.
